ChatGPT是由OpenAI开发的一款基于人工智能的聊天机器人,它能够通过自然语言处理技术与用户进行对话。ChatGPT在各个领域都有广泛的应用,包括客服、教育、娱乐等。在数据库管理领域,ChatG...
ChatGPT是由OpenAI开发的一款基于人工智能的聊天机器人,它能够通过自然语言处理技术与用户进行对话。ChatGPT在各个领域都有广泛的应用,包括客服、教育、娱乐等。在数据库管理领域,ChatGPT也可以帮助用户进行数据的更新和维护。
数据库更新概述
数据库更新是数据库管理中的重要环节,它涉及到数据的增加、删除、修改等操作。在更新数据库时,需要确保数据的准确性和一致性。ChatGPT可以通过编写相应的脚本或命令来实现数据库的更新操作。
ChatGPT与数据库连接
要使用ChatGPT更新数据库,首先需要建立与数据库的连接。这通常涉及到以下步骤:
1. 确定数据库类型(如MySQL、Oracle、SQL Server等)。
2. 使用ChatGPT的API或命令行工具连接到数据库。
3. 输入正确的连接参数,如用户名、密码、数据库名等。
编写更新脚本
一旦建立了数据库连接,就可以开始编写更新脚本。以下是一些常见的数据库更新操作:
- 增加数据:使用INSERT语句向数据库表中插入新记录。
- 删除数据:使用DELETE语句从数据库表中删除记录。
- 修改数据:使用UPDATE语句修改数据库表中的现有记录。
ChatGPT可以帮助用户编写这些脚本,并提供实时的语法检查和错误提示。
数据验证与一致性检查
在执行数据库更新之前,进行数据验证和一致性检查是非常重要的。ChatGPT可以通过以下方式帮助进行这些检查:
- 数据完整性检查:确保数据符合预定义的规则和约束。
- 事务管理:使用事务来确保数据更新的原子性、一致性、隔离性和持久性。
自动化更新流程
为了提高效率,可以将数据库更新操作自动化。ChatGPT可以与自动化工具(如Cron作业、Windows任务计划程序等)集成,定期执行预定义的更新任务。
错误处理与日志记录
在数据库更新过程中,可能会遇到各种错误。ChatGPT可以帮助用户:
- 错误捕获:在脚本中添加错误处理逻辑,捕获并处理异常。
- 日志记录:记录更新过程中的关键信息,便于后续分析和调试。
性能优化与监控
数据库更新可能会对性能产生影响。ChatGPT可以提供以下帮助:
- 性能分析:使用性能分析工具来识别潜在的瓶颈。
- 监控工具:集成监控工具来实时跟踪数据库性能。
ChatGPT在数据库更新方面具有很大的潜力,它可以帮助用户简化更新流程,提高数据管理的效率和准确性。通过编写脚本、自动化操作、错误处理和性能优化,ChatGPT可以成为数据库管理员的得力助手。随着人工智能技术的不断发展,ChatGPT在数据库管理领域的应用将会更加广泛。